How to Find the Photographer Who’s Right for You 

As you begin your search for wedding photographers in San Antonio, TX, here are a few things I always encourage couples to think about:

– Do you connect with their work emotionally? When you look through their photos, can you feel something? 
– Do their values align with yours? Whether faith, storytelling, or simplicity—your photographer should reflect what matters to you. 
– Do you feel seen and understood? The right photographer will care about who you are, not just what your day looks like. 
– Are they intentional with their approach? Look for someone who takes the time to know your story and photograph it with purpose.

If you’re planning your day at one of the beautiful wedding venues in San Antonio, your photographer should also know how to work with different lighting, timelines, and spaces—without losing the heart of the day.
